I need to replace the tires on my 98 Series 1. The truck is on its 2nd set and is ready for the third at 62,000 miles. My wife drives it mostly around town. About half the miles are done on highways. Every once in a while I will drive down a gravel or dirt road for a couple of miles. We live just north of Dallas so the tires are subject to a lot of heat during the summer and very little snow or ice in the winter.
I want a set of tires that will provide good handling, traction and extended wear under the above conditions. Any suggestions?

In Western Australia the Disco comes supplied with Michellins they are great on the road and give about 50,000 to 60,000 miles and give very little road noise. The down side is they do chop out on hard dirt or rocky roads.The Bridgestone Duellers with road tread biass are a good compromise they are not as quite on the road but don't chop out on the dirt and still give reasonable milage. Western Australia has a warm to hot climate we never see snow, therefore I can't comment on how the tyres perform in cool to cold climates. Hope the info is usefull.
